EE Times: “Chip designer Via Technologies Inc. is moving into motherboard production
to boost sales of its flagship product, the P4x266, a Pentium 4 compatible chip set. The
decision, announced Monday, Oct. 15, surprised many familiar with the company, who
generally viewed it as a desperate gamble in the company’s showdown with Intel Corp. over
licensing fees for the chip set.”
